#UConn has landed a commitment from a JUCO LB



Eli Thomas is a 6-2 220lb LB/Safety from Elmira New York attending Lackawanna College (Dec Grad) Scranton PA. Other offers from CCSU, Sacred Heart and Wagner. He was just up to UConn this past weekend. He will enroll in January and have two years of eligibility left.

On changing his mind on holding off committing till after his season (Richie S @ Storrs Central):

>>Originally Thomas said he was planning on holding off on a decision until after the season. However he recently had a change of heart after the visit.“Realizing how much my mother loved it, and really thinking about the opportunity at hand. I decided to commit,” Thomas said.<<
 

>>Thomas, at 6-foot-2 and 220 pounds, has put on 40 pounds of muscle since high school while still retaining the 4.5-second 40-yard dash speed that presented so many problems for Express opponents and is a big reason UConn is giving him this chance.

"A lot of schools noticed I played sideline to sideline a lot," he said. "That's what they liked about me. My speed is definitely one of my biggest assets."<<
